Overview

A sample topology where Management Center Virtual connects to a Threat Defense Virtual instance, which is deployed in a private or public cloud and interfaces with internal servers and internet-facing networks, including potential east-west traffic flows.

In this sample topology, Management Center Virtual is connected to the management port of the threat defense virtual deployed on an external private or public cloud. The Threat Defense Virtual is connected to both the internet and an internal server. The internet can also be another server in an east-west traffic flow topology.
